Unlike services such as GMRS or business radios, ham radios do not need type acceptance for operation on amateur bands. They range from the mundane (allocations of different bands) to very specific in use by police, fire departments, amusement parks, etc. [1] The list of frequency ranges is called a band allocation, which may be set by international agreements, and national regulations.
